Data engineering roles in sport are responsible for building and maintaining the infrastructure that powers analytics. From ingesting tracking and event data to managing cloud data warehouses and building reliable pipelines, data engineers are the foundation on which sports analytics teams operate.
These roles typically involve working with large volumes of time-series data from tracking providers, video platforms, and internal systems. You might be building real-time streaming pipelines for in-game data, managing a Snowflake or Databricks environment, or developing APIs that deliver data to coaching dashboards and front-office tools.
